Abris Bendes is a Researcher at Abo Akademi University's Faculty of Natural Sciences and Engineering, within the Biochemistry and Cell Biology department. Their work focuses on malaria parasite biology, enzymology, and structural biology, particularly studying actin capping proteins and dUTPase enzymes. They are part of the InFLAMES flagship program, which develops solutions based on immune system research.
Research interests include understanding molecular mechanisms in parasitic pathogens like Plasmodium, enzyme inhibition pathways, and structural biology applications in drug discovery. Their publications (2011–2022) highlight studies on actin dynamics in malaria parasites and enzymatic processes in Mycobacterium tuberculosis.
